• FFmpeg常用基本命令行


      一、获取视频信息

      1、查看本地的视频信息

        ffmpeg -i D:AIili_dataoutput.mp4

        

      2、查看远程http视频信息

        ffmpeg -i http://static.tripbe.com/videofiles/20121214/9533522808.f4v.mp4

        

       二、通用选项

        1、-L  查看ffmpeg工具版本

          ffmpeg -L

        2、-h  查看帮助

          ffmpeg -h

        3、-codecs  编解码方式

        4、-f  fmt 强迫采用格式fmt (文件格式,如wav, avi等)如不指定该选项,则根据文件扩展名自动探测格式

        5、-i  filename  输入文件

        6、-y  覆盖输出文件

        7、-t duration 设置录制/转码的时长 单位秒,也支持hh:mm:ss格式

        8、-ss position 指定起始时间,hh:mm:ss格式也支持 ,例如:下面等效

          ffmpeg -ss 20 -i D:AIili_data est.mp4 -t 30 D:AIili_dataoutput1.mp4

          ffmpeg -ss 00:00:20 -i D:AIili_data est.mp4 -t 30 D:AIili_dataoutput1.mp4

        9、-fs   limit_size      set the limit file size in bytes

        10、-ac 设置声道数 -ac 1     1就是单声道 ,节省一半容量

        11、-b:v  主要是控制平均码率。-b:v 2000k

        12、-vcodec  视频编码格式转换 强制使用codec编解码方式

        13、-acodec   音频编码方式 是aac   ffmpeg -i test.mp4 -acodec aac -vn output.aac

        14、-vn  不做视频记录

        15、-an  不做音频记录

        16、转码 ffmpeg -i h265.ts -vcodec h264 -acodec aac -strict -2 h264.mp4

  • 相关阅读:
    怎么让图片居中显示?
    上传代码出现弹出框“请确保已在git中配置您的user.name和user.email”解决方法
    window.open()下载文件: 在当前页面打开方法
    修改网站颜色为黑白 (100% 灰度)/全页置灰
    ZMQ简单使用
    CCXT
    Python描述符详解
    自定义序列的修改、散列和切片
    使用__slots__类属性节省空间
    QGraphicsView实现虚拟摇杆
  • 原文地址:https://www.cnblogs.com/shaosks/p/14900281.html
Copyright © 2020-2023  润新知